WebTrichotillomania. January 2013 Brian Chicoine, MD - Medical Director, Adult Down Syndrome Center. Trichotillomania is “hair loss from repeated urges to pull or twist the hair until it breaks off. Patients are unable to stop this behavior, even as their hair becomes thinner” ( s ee this link ). The cause of trichotillomania is not known. WebJan 22, 2024 · The anatomical ear structure of children with Down Syndrome has characteristics that may predispose them to hearing loss. Most of the hearing loss seen in Down Syndrome is conductive hearing loss.
